2011-05-31 132 views
0

我使用HtmlUnit进行网络测试,它很棒。但我也想测试整个页面的下载时间,包括链接的图像,JavaScript和CSS页面,以及确保链接有效。有没有办法告诉HtmlUnit抓取任何给定的HTML页面的所有依赖关系?有没有办法告诉HtmlUnit抓住所有依赖

回答

0

我不知道任何事情是HtmlUnit本身的一部分,但这并不难。

自己拉出所有依赖链接—例如使用getByXPath()来检索所有的<a>标签—并遍历它们并让HtmlUnit分别拉下。

只要小心使用它来确定下载时间:除非您模拟“真实”浏览器如何并行检索事物,否则您将无法获得准确的度量。像Xenu这样的工具将会是这项工作的更好工具。

相关问题